Rail Services: market situation between China and Europe

In addition to our air and sea freight service portfolio, DACHSER offers multimodal, reliable rail services with an extensive coverage, connecting economic centers of major importance in China and Europe.

Via the North Corridor, the so-called Trans-Siberian Route, we connect Hamburg, Warsaw, Vienna and Bratislava with Chinese main terminals cities like Changchun, Shenyang, Suzhou and Dongguan. 

To and from Duisburg, Hamburg, Neuss, Ludwigshafen, Vienna, Bratislava and Warsaw, we serve the South Corridor, also known as New Silk Road to the Chinese hinterland areas of Xi'an, Chengdu, Chongqing and Zhengzhou.

Not only Block Trains but also Full Container Load (FCL) and Less-Than-Container-Load (LCL) are possible on this service, it includes Consolidation Container Services (LCL-LCL) as well as Customer Consolidations (LCL-FCL).

+++ FLASH UPDATE NEWS +++

Due to high demand at the borders to Mongolia as well as to Kazakhstan, Chinese railways decided to cut most of the planned train departures in direction to Europe for November and December. As this is effecting all platforms, the expected backlog for December will tighten the available capacity furthermore.

Becasue of the imbalances transporting between Europe and Asia, there is also a serious shortage in available equipment like container and wagons. Therefore a pre-booking of at least 14 days in advanced is highly recommended.
